Transaction 8778805d743db3003a4e22c70117869834fc7eea4fc0f3e11d722c7d7d6d1c4e
1 Input
1 Output
-
8778805d743db3003a4e22c70117869834fc7eea4fc0f3e11d722c7d7d6d1c4e:0
- value
- 17620280
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e4e402dda246fd9029b8c3173e50e41ad8b3e0a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QBeNgNfdDjYYLQgYU97mZLKEoPiDVUQeM